I'm about to go on vacation for 11 days, 4 of which will comprise the 2008 Tour de Rizbee. For each of the past four years my son and I have done a disc golf road trip where we drive like crazy and play lots of disc golf (www.teamrizbee.com). Last year's trip covered 21 days, 60 courses, 1,000 holes, and 11 states. This year's trip is much shorter but should be pretty exciting. My daughter is joining us this year, and since she's not as interested in disc golf we'll be doing some other activities on our trip as well.
We'll be flying from San Diego to Syracuse, NY to visit my mom for a few days in Rome, NY. Then we head out on the road - 4 1/2 days to cover as much of New England and points between as possible. Possible stops include Hyzer Creek in NY, Sugarbush and Mt. Calais in VT, Pinnacle in NH, Sabbatus in ME, Maple Hills in MA and Wickham in CT. Maybe Warwick on the way back. Much of this may depend on the weather, as it looks like there are thunderstorms forecast for next week. We're also planning on stopping at the Ben & Jerry's factory in VT, L.L. Bean in Freeport, ME, and the site of the former Frisbie Pie Co. factory in Bridgeport, CT. After the road trip it's back to visit mom for 4 more days and then home.
